Jones Spring Campout May 16-18
Troop 1468's second spring camp was held in the Jones Spring area, near Townsend. A hike in to the carry-in sites revealed a secluded lake with plenty of opportunity to fish, hike, and take in the sights. The boys got to practice their lightweight camping skills--it's been amazing to see the transformation from "I'll bring everything but the kitchen sink" packing for the weekend to "What can I fit in one backpack?" The boys also did a fantastic job with their menus, creating a "no refrigeration needed" shopping list and setting troop records for the least amount of money spent per person and generating virtually no leftovers while still keeping everybody fed.
